In a hurry? Read the recaplet for a nutshell description! Finished? Click here to close.Abi isn't sure why they kept her around, but she doesn't want to leave yet. Her latest strategy is to convince Lisa that she's on the bottom of her final four alliance, and she won't make it to the finals. Lisa isn't buying it, but she knows that she needs to keep Abi on her side whether to go to the finals or as a jury member.
Reward Challenge: The Survivors have to climb up and slide down a ramp, and retrieve two bags of rings from the water. Then they have to toss the rings onto pegs. Skupin and Malcolm are neck and neck throughout, but Skupin gets all his rings on pegs first and wins. He chooses Malcolm and Lisa to come with him on a helicopter ride to eat pizza on a boat.
Poor Denise is left on the beach with Abi, who doesn't get why she wasn't chosen to go on Reward, like does she still not get that no one likes her? Meanwhile, on the boat, Lisa, Skupin, and Malcolm make a final three deal. Skupin also drinks soda for the first time in thirty years and gets a little loopy.
The next morning, Denise discovers that she got bit or stung by something in the night and she seems to be having an allergic reaction, but she decides to try to suck it up and carry on.
Immunity Challenge: Cross a bridge and retrieve puzzle pieces, and use them to assemble a maze and then solve it. Malcolm is in first place but he falls off the bridge and has to start over. This gives Denise a chance to solve the maze, but she can't quite put it together and in an impressive feat, Malcolm comes from behind and wins the challenge. So now he has Immunity PLUS he has to play his Idol tonight, as it's the last night it can be played. If I were Denise, I would ask him to give me his Idol so that Lisa and Skupin don't start any shenanigans. That would let her know if Malcolm is really planning on taking her to the finals.
Denise does ask Malcolm for his Idol and he says she doesn't need it so he doesn't give it to her. Lisa and Skupin consider their options. They know keeping Abi makes sense from a finals perspective, but they also know they'll need Denise's challenge expertise to keep Malcolm from winning immunity in the next challenge.
At Tribal Council, Abi makes a big pitch to keep her around, since she thinks either Malcolm or Denise is going to win, so Lisa and Skupin are stupid to keep them instead of her.
